Released by Symantec before the information management division split into Veritas Technologies, Backup Exec 2014 (specifically version 14.1 Build 1786) was designed as a physical and virtual server backup solution for small to mid-sized businesses (SMBs). It was a major release aimed at addressing performance issues and restoring features that were heavily criticized in its predecessor, Backup Exec 2012.
